The nightangle was a credulous creature as she believed the frog when he claimed that he was a melodious singer who had the most splendid baritone  in whole of the Bingle Bog. The nightangle was told by him that he was the only trainer there in the Bingle Bog  who could train her well and make her a good singer as he was.She was gullible by nature and easily believed the frog's self-praise. So she compared her to Mozart, the famous prodigy Austrian composer.
